Organization Overview
Family Service Of Roanoke Valley is a mid-size nonprofit that has been operating for 54 years, with 13 years of IRS 990 filings on record (2011–2023). Revenue has grown at a compound annual rate of 1.7%.

Filing History
IRS 990 filing history for Family Service Of Roanoke Valley show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:
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Family Service Of Roanoke Valley's revenue has grown by 21.8%, moving from $2.3M to $2.8M. Total assets increased by 18.6% over the same period, from $2.1M to $2.5M. Total functional expenses fell by 1.2%, from $2.2M to $2.2M. In its most recent filing year (2023), Family Service Of Roanoke Valley reported a surplus of $548K, with revenue exceeding expenses. The organization holds $870K in liabilities against $2.5M in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 35.4%), resulting in net assets of $1.6M.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
